Person |
package exam3; |
public class Person { |
private String name; |
private char sex; |
private String id; |
private String phone; |
private String email; |
public Person() |
{ |
System.out.println( "调用了个人构造方法Person()" ); |
} |
public Person(String name, char sex,String id) |
{ |
this .name=name; |
this .sex=sex; |
this .id=id; |
} |
public String getName() |
{ |
return name; |
} |
public void setName(String name) |
{ |
this .name = name; |
} |
public String getId() |
{ |
return id; |
} |
public void setId(String id) |
{ |
this .id = id; |
} |
public char getSex() |
{ |
return sex; |
} |
public void setSex( char sex) |
{ |
this .sex = sex; |
} |
public String getPhone() |
{ |
return phone; |
} |
public void setPhone(String phone) |
{ |
this .phone = phone; |
} |
public String getEmail() |
{ |
return email; |
} |
public void setEmail(String email) |
{ |
this .email = email; |
} |
public String toString() |
{ |
return this .getName()+ this .getSex()+ this .getId(); |
} |
} |
class Student extends Person |
{ |
private String sClass; |
private long sNo; |
public Student() |
{ |
System.out.println( "调用了学生构造方法Student()" ); |
} |
public Student(String name, char sex,String id, long sNo) |
{ |
super (name,sex,id); |
this .sNo=sNo; |
System.out.println(sClass); |
} |
public long getsNo() |
{ |
return sNo; |
} |
public void setsNo( long sNo) |
{ |
this .sNo=sNo; |
} |
public String getsClass() { |
return sClass; |
} |
public void setsClass(String sClass) { |
this .sClass = sClass; |
} |
public String toString() |
{ |
return "姓名" + this .getName()+ "性别" + this .getSex()+ "ID" + this .getId()+ "学号" + this .getsNo()+ "邮箱" + this .getEmail()+ "联系方式" + this .getPhone(); |
} |
public void setSex(String string) { |
// TODO 自动生成的方法存根 |
|
} |
|
|
} |
TestStudent |
package exam3; |
public class TestStudent { |
public static void main(String[] args) |
{ |
Student s1= new Student(); |
s1.setName( "刘德华" ); |
s1.setSex( '男' ); |
s1.setId( " 1111111111 " ); |
s1.setsNo( 2008002 ); |
s1.setEmail( " gzdx@126.com" ); |
s1.setPhone( " 88078549 " ); |
System.out.println(s1.toString()); |
} |
} |